The numbers tell a sobering story. Statewide snowpack sits at only about 18 percent of normal levels right now. In some parts of the Sierra Nevada, it’s even worse. Northern areas are scraping by with just 6 percent, while central and southern sections fare slightly better at 21 and 32 percent respectively. These figures aren’t just statistics on a chart – they represent real challenges for water supplies, agriculture, and fire safety across the state.

Understanding California’s Unique Water Reality

Most people don’t realize just how much California relies on winter snow rather than year-round rain. The snow that builds up in the mountains acts like a giant natural reservoir. As it melts slowly through spring and summer, it feeds rivers, reservoirs, farms, and cities. When that snow is missing, the whole system feels the strain.

This year’s pattern was unusual from the start. Warmer storms coming off the Pacific brought more rain than snow to lower elevations. While that helped fill some reservoirs in the short term, it didn’t create the deep snowpack the state depends on for the long haul. Then came an unusually warm March that melted what little snow had accumulated much earlier than normal.

The Science Behind Snowpack Shortfalls

When warmer air holds more moisture, storms can dump heavy rain instead of building snow at higher elevations. Scientists have been tracking this trend, and it appears to be happening more frequently. The result is what some call a “snow drought” – not necessarily from lack of precipitation overall, but from temperatures that prevent snow from sticking around.

Looking back, we saw something similar during the severe drought years between 2012 and 2016. In 2015, snow levels hit historic lows in many places. Some Sierra Nevada sites recorded almost no snow at all. That period taught everyone how vulnerable the state’s water system can be when winter conditions don’t cooperate.

The snowpack serves as California’s most important natural water storage system. When it’s weak, every other part of the water network feels pressure.

The early melt this year adds another layer of worry. Instead of a steady release of water through late spring and summer, much of it came rushing down earlier. This timing mismatch can lead to higher runoff in some periods and shortages later when demand peaks.

Wildfire Risks on the Rise

Low snowpack often goes hand in hand with increased fire danger. Drier vegetation, lower soil moisture, and warmer temperatures create perfect conditions for fires to start and spread quickly. As we move deeper into the dry season, crews are already preparing for what could be an active year.

It’s not just about the mountains either. The foothills and valleys can dry out faster when snowmelt contributions are reduced. This puts more communities at risk, especially those near wildland-urban interfaces where homes meet open spaces.

  • Earlier drying of vegetation across large areas
  • Reduced moisture in soils and streams
  • Higher temperatures accelerating evaporation
  • Potential for rapid fire spread under windy conditions

Impacts on Agriculture and Food Production

California grows a huge portion of the nation’s fruits, vegetables, and nuts. Many of these crops depend heavily on reliable irrigation from snowmelt-fed systems. When water availability tightens, farmers face tough choices about what to plant, how much land to fallow, and how to stretch limited supplies.

Some operations have invested in efficient irrigation technology and groundwater storage, but those solutions have limits. Prolonged dry conditions can also affect livestock operations and the broader rural economy that depends on agriculture.

Effects on Ecosystems and Wildlife

Beyond human uses, natural ecosystems rely on that seasonal snowmelt too. Rivers and streams need adequate flows to support fish populations, especially during spawning seasons. Wetlands and riparian areas can dry up faster, affecting birds and other wildlife.

Forests stressed by drought become more susceptible to pests and disease. This creates a feedback loop where weakened trees burn more easily, potentially changing landscapes for decades to come.

Healthy snowpack supports everything from mountain meadows to downstream delta ecosystems. The current shortfall ripples through the entire natural system.

Reservoir Levels and Urban Water Supply

The good news is that some reservoirs received decent inflows from those warmer winter storms. However, the lack of sustained snowmelt means those gains might not last as long as usual. Cities and water districts are reviewing their storage and conservation plans.

Urban residents may see renewed calls for water conservation as summer heat arrives. While mandatory restrictions aren’t on the table yet in most places, voluntary measures could help stretch supplies further.

RegionSnowpack LevelPotential Impact
Northern Sierra6% of normalSevere water shortage risk
Central Sierra21% of normalModerate to high stress
Southern Sierra32% of normalElevated concerns

These regional differences matter because water systems connect across the state. Northern shortages can affect southern deliveries through major aqueducts and canals.

The Broader Climate Picture

California has always experienced wet and dry cycles. What seems different now is the intensity and how temperature influences precipitation patterns. Warmer winters shift more storms toward rain rather than snow, even when total moisture isn’t dramatically reduced.

This creates the whiplash effect we’ve seen recently – massive snow years followed by sharp drops. Managing through these swings requires flexible strategies and long-term investment in infrastructure.

Economic Implications Across Sectors

Beyond immediate water concerns, low snowpack can ripple through the economy. Tourism in mountain areas might see changes if summer recreation opportunities shift. Energy production from hydroelectric sources could face constraints if reservoir levels drop. Insurance costs in fire-prone regions often reflect heightened risks.

These economic pressures highlight why water security matters to everyone, not just farmers or environmentalists. The interconnected nature of California’s economy means that water issues touch nearly every sector in some way.
